Taylor's tractor-trailer rigs sell for $150,000. A customer wishes to buy a rig on a lease purchase plan over seven years, with the first payment to be made at the inception of the lease. Interest is at 12%.
Required:
a. Compute the amount of the annual lease payment and the gross amount (total payments) due under the lease.
b. Compute the amount of interest income earned by Taylor's for the first year of the lease.
